As a student of marxism and historian of ideas, as an original thinker and a writer of exceptional brilliance, george lichtheim, who died in april of this year, first came to the attention of general readers with the publication of marxism in 1961.

George lichtheim admitted that populism might indeed be suited to the third world, more so than marxism, but the idea as propagated by sections of the new left that it could serve as a model for more advanced countries struck him as grotesque. This book, first published in 1961 and revised in 1964, is both a critical study of a body of thought and an historical account of how marxist theory arose from the context of european history in the 19th century.
